Restaurant Revenue Management: Examining Reservation Policy Implications at Fine Dining Restaurants

Hernandez, Nanishka 01 January 2015 (has links)
In the restaurant industry, some patrons do not honor their reservations, especially on holidays. Grounded in postpositivism and system theories, the purpose of this comparative study was to examine the impact of implementing a credit card payment policy for fine dining restaurants reservations and no shows after implementation of a credit card guarantee policy at a high-end hotel located in the southeast United States. Data were collected from archival records provided by the hotel executives. According to the results of a Wilcoxon Signed Rank test, there was a statistically significant decrease in the number of no shows, p < .001, after the implementation of the credit card guarantee policy. In a paired sample t-test, there was a statistically significant decrease in the number of reservations, p < .001, after implementation of the credit card guarantee policy. The implications for positive social change include the potential to increase understanding of payment policies as they relate to the restaurant industry. Service industry managers can benefit from implementing payment policies that can vary from specific dates, seasons, and type of services. Customers will also benefit by being able to make reservations not originally possible due to demand. The current study adds to service industry knowledge, increasing the understanding of payment policies as they relate to restaurant industry. Conducting a similar study in other service industries in the future may lead to a better understanding of the nature of policies and customers' traits and behaviors.

Comparison of Current On-line Payment Technologies

Mandadi, Ravi January 2006 (has links)
<p>The purpose of this thesis work was to make a survey of current on-line payment technologies and find out which are they and how do they work? Compare and analyze them from a security point of view, as well as a usability point of view. What is good? What is bad? What is lacking?</p><p>To achieve this purpose, an overview of the current on-line payment technologies was acquired through academic books and papers, Internet sites, magazines. Basic cryptographic and security related techniques were studied for the security analysis of current on-line payment systems.</p><p>In this work, various current on-line payment systems were classified into two groups [Macro and Micro on-line payment systems]. This classification was based on the mode of on-line payment transactions. To analyze these on-line payment systems, a set of payment system requirements were formed [Security Issues, Usability Issues, Anonymity, Scalability etc].</p><p>Under the category of Macro payment system, Credit Card payment system, Debit Card payment system, Stored Value Card payment system, Electronic Check payment system, Electronic Cash payment system, Electronic account transfer payment system and mobile payment system transactions were examined.</p><p>Under the category of Micro payment system, Hash Chain based Payment System, Hash Collisions and Hash sequences based Payment Systems, Shared Secrete Keys based Payment Systems and Probability based payment systems were examined.</p><p>Based on the requirements of payment system, these on-line payment systems were analyzed and compared. In the analysis phase, the advantages and drawbacks of these payment systems were figured out.</p><p>It was found from the study that the credit card based payment systems are the most widely used means of conducting on-line payments. It is evident that credit card based payment systems satisfy stakeholder requirements the best, as they offer more flexible payment options, having a large user-base, benefit from familiarity and simplicity of use and also allow international payments. The other on-line payment systems lack this flexibility</p><p>It can also be extracted from the study that users want more simplified, convenient and secure on-line payment systems. Thus the futuristic on-line payment systems will have all secure payment options into one system.</p>

知識管理中推論機制之研究–應用在信用卡行銷

葛世豪, Ko, Shih Hao Unknown Date (has links)
銀行個人金融中,信用卡產品的競爭相當激烈,而為了吸引持卡人消費,行銷人員也設計了許多的信用卡行銷優惠。現有銀行的資訊部門為了滿足新行銷方案的設計與行銷方案優惠的判斷,採取的作法是在現有的系統上不斷的新增外掛程式,來滿足新的需求,但這樣的作法會產生許多問題,每當一個新的行銷優惠方案產生後,就必須在現有系統上新增外掛,不但可能會危及現有系統的穩定度,同時這些外掛的系統會造成系統的複雜度,增加維護與修改的困難度與成本。 本研究運用邏輯符號以及物件導向的觀念,分析行銷人員設計信用卡行銷優惠方案,提出規則模型以及事實模型。規則模型提供了一套通用的邏輯符號架構,並將邏輯的表達透過XML的標準,轉化成電腦可處理的形式;而事實模型架構出通用的事實模版架構,提供在事實與實際資料庫對應上的處理標準。並透過以規則為基礎的推論機制,建構出實際的系統,來驗證研究的可行性。希望透過本研究的規則模型以及事實模型架構,將行銷人員的知識結構化與知識儲存,達到邏輯符號的可重複使用性與可延伸性,並提供了系統未來修改與延伸的彈性與準則,改善過去新增行銷優惠方案時,就必須增加外掛系統的問題。 / Competition for credit card is sharp in personal finance of banking and financial service industry. In order to attract customer to use credit card, the marketing staff designs lots of marketing campaigns. But for information system department of the bank, it takes more effort to manage and process these campaigns. The approach that the information system staff uses is to create lots of plug-in systems. But this approach harms the stability of the system architecture and increases the complexity of maintenance and cost. In this research, we use the concept of symbolic logic and object-oriented concept to analysis how the marketing staff designs the credit card campaigns and provide the rule model and fact model. The rule model provides standard symbolic logic architecture and uses the XML standard to transform logic symbols into RuleML. The fact model is a standard architecture and provides the mapping between facts and database. And we build a prototype rule-based system to validate the feasibility. The research contributes to construct and store the knowledge of credit card marketing campaign of the marketing staff by the rule model and the fact model. And the rule-based system in this research also provides flexibility and modifiability in the future to reform the drawback of original plug-in system approach.

企業併購對顧客關係管理的影響 / An investigation of customer relationship management in post-merger

游昀臻, Yu, Yun Chen Unknown Date (has links)
企業透過併購為了要獲得更多資源以建立競爭優勢的策略。過去很多研究關注在兩家公司之間的流程與資源整合,而忽略合併後因為文化與系統整合的衝突而產生對顧客關係管理的影響。理論上,合併後的公司除了獲得更多資源之外也要能夠獲得更多的顧客,但是實際上因為兩家公司組織間擁有不同的企業流程、文化與資訊系統,有可能無法維持顧客關係的水準。本研究的目的希望了解企業併購對顧客關係管理的影響以及希望找出影響顧客關係管理的成功因素。本研究選擇金融產業的信用卡業務作為研究對象,因為在金融產業裡消費金融是一項需要依賴顧客關係管理,才能維繫顧客忠誠度與獲得更多的顧客。 本研究透過文獻蒐集找出可能影響顧客關係管理的關鍵因素,建立研究架構。並透過兩階段驗證與及擴充研究架構。第一階段,我們先定義出與顧客關係管理相關的信用卡指標,然後蒐集台灣過去八年有從事合併活動的銀行在信用卡業務上的資料,並透過指標分析以了解銀行在合併前至合併後的顧客關係管理成效,目的是希望了解企業在併購後顧客關係管理的維繫。第二階段,我們針對所選的個案去做深度的跨個案研究,目的是希望了解企業可以維持顧客關係的重要成功因素。 本研究結果透過跨個案分析驗證我們在文獻中發現的關鍵因素,並說明這些因素如何影響顧客關係。此外還發現可能會影響管理顧客關係的其他影響因素。本研究發現關鍵因素分別為1.顧客重整與服務調整2.服務文化調整3.流程整合4.資訊整合5.溝通6.組織慣性改變7.企業轉換時標準程序的建立8.合併後的顧客關懷。而影響併購後顧客關係管理的因素分別為1.策略目的2.客群的規模3.品牌效益4.組織心態。透過本研究可了解併購後維繫顧客關係的重要性,並提供影響顧客關係管理的成功因素,以幫助企業維繫顧客忠誠度與獲得更多的顧客。 / Mergers and acquisitions (M&A) represent a strategic approach for businesses to acquire resources and build competitive advantages. Many studies have investigated the process and results of the resource integration between two firms. Some cases have revealed satisfactory results in building asset portfolios and some cases uncovered a downside to merger due to conflicts in cultural and system integration. One of the key objectives of business acquisition is to expand business operations in providing customers with superior products and services. However, there is limited understanding about how customers react to the post-merger services. In theory, the merged enterprise should be able to leverage the assets and knowledge in growing and retaining customers, but in reality the customer relationships may not be well managed because of a lack of synergy between the merged organizations. The objective of this study is to examine the effect of mergers and acquisitions on customer relationship management (CRM), and we select the credit card business in the banking industry as our focus of study. Finance industries, especially consumer banks, rely heavily on CRM for targeting customers, promoting services, building deep knowledge, and generating revenue. M&A is the most applied approach in increasing business scope and enhancing services for engaging more customers. Based on the literature about M&A and CRM, this study builds a framework for data collection, and the study is conducted in two stages. First, we collect data on CRM performance of credit card business in banks in Taiwan that have experienced M&A in the past eight years, and we compare CRM performance before and after mergers. Second, we do in-depth case study on selected cases regarding possible causes for CRM success in post-merger. The research results not only verified and enhanced the list of critical factors for CRM success but also discovered influential factors that can affect the effectiveness of CRM after merger. The critical factors are: strategy for rebuilding customer base and service portfolio, service culture, process integration, technology integration, communication and organizational inertia, standard of procedures of the business transition and customer care after the merger. The additional influential factors are: strategic purpose, customer base, brand effect, and organizational mindsets. It is hoped that we can learn from these cases about managing customer relationships after a merger and help companies develop effective plans for building synergy in CRM after M&A.

Impactos da regulamentação do pagamento mínimo de cartões de crédito no mercado brasileiro

Marchetti, Jonas Simões Coelho 09 February 2015 (has links)

Escolhas individuais e bem-estar financeiro: três ensaios utilizando microdados

Santos, Danilo Braun 27 January 2016 (has links)

Ensaios sobre plataformas, agentes heterogêneos e discriminação de preços / Essays on platforms, heterogeneous agents and price discrimination

Gabriel Garber 02 December 2014 (has links)
Apresentamos três estudos sobre os assuntos mencionados no título. O primeiro, econométrico, avalia os impactos da quebra de exclusividade no lado credenciador da indústria de cartões de pagamentos no Brasil que ocorreu em 2010. Por um lado, tentamos a construção de um grupo de controle e, por outro, fazemos a decomposição dos preços em markup e custo marginal. As estimações, que empregam um banco de dados com informações individuais para os maiores lojistas de cada setor, apontam para o sucesso dessa intervenção na promoção da concorrência. No segundo artigo, propomos que cobranças indevidas feitas por instituições financeiras podem ser uma forma de discriminação de preços, já que sua devolução demanda esforço dos consumidores. Nesse caso, tendo em vista que as cobranças indevidas ótimas dependem do perfil do consumidor, construímos um teste baseado numa função de verossimilhança para mostrar como a informação de reclamações poderia ser utilizada para detectar esse tipo de comportamento, mesmo quando a autoridade interessada nesse monitoramento sabe menos sobre os clientes que a instituição financeira. O terceiro artigo, teórico aplicado, estuda o comportamento de plataformas comerciais em mercados de dois lados nos quais os papéis de compradores e vendedores são bem definidos e há heterogeneidade dentro de cada um desses grupos de agentes. Diferentemente do que ocorre no caso em que os interesses são simétricos, no lado vendedor não ocorre autosseleção dos participantes e a plataforma passa a ter um papel de certificação dos vendedores, criando ambientes de qualidade selecionada onde um preço maior pode ser cobrado dos compradores. / This thesis has three papers related to the subject in the title. The first one, an econometric paper, evaluates the impact of a break of exclusivity promoted by Brazilian authorities in the payment card acquiring industry in 2010. We use two frameworks: in one of them, we try to identify categories of merchants to use as control group, while in the other we decompose prices into markup and marginal cost elements. The estimations employ a dataset of individual merchants with information for the largest ones in each category. The results indicate success in promoting some competition. In the second paper, we argue that undue charges made by financial institutions may be a form of price discrimination, since their reversion requires effort from consumers. Given that in such case the optimal undue charges depend on consumers profiles, we build a likelihood function based test to show how information on complaints might be used to detect this sort of behavior, even when the relevant authority knows less about clients than the financial institution. The third one, an applied theoretical paper, analyses the behavior of commercial platforms in two-sided markets where the roles of buyers and sellers are well defined and there is heterogeneity within each of these groups of agents. Differently from what happens in a setting with symmetric interests, in the seller side no self-selection takes place and the platform gains an important quality certification role, creating spaces for trade where seller quality is higher and buyers are willing to pay more.

Financial inclusion and electronic payments: explaining electronic payments in Brazil with principal components analysis and Sarimax models / A inclusão financeira e o setor de pagamentos eletrônicos: um estudo dos meios de pagamentos eletrônicos no Brasil através da análise de componentes principais e modelos Sarimax

Frederic Auguste Arnaud Rozeira de Sampaio Mariz 27 October 2017 (has links)
Financial inclusion is a public policy objective that fosters development through access to financial services for all. Financial inclusion can be defined as access, usage and quality of financial services. Inclusion of individuals and small enterprises has made considerable progress but it has also reached excesses in some situations. Regulatory changes and technological innovation have helped the expansion of financial services. Our contribution to the literature is threefold. First, we expand the large body of research that focuses on financial inclusion based on access to credit, through our analysis of payments. We provide an unique analysis of the quality dimension of payments, which we define as a catalyst between the access and usage dimensions. Second, we provide a detailed analysis of the Brazilian payment market, which transacts close to $400bn per year, in the scarce literature on developing countries. Third, we isolate the determinants of electronic payments through statistical methods, including a principal component analysis and auto regressive models (SARIMA, SARIMAX), which have not yet been used by researchers. We find that four macro characteristicshave a strong explanatory power: bank credit card lending, active population, retail sales and cash-in-circulation. Suprisingly, we find that cash-in-circulation presents a positive relationship with electronic payments, suggesting a possible distrust of citizens towards the banking system, high levels of informality, and shedding a new light on the precautionary principle described by Keynes. Our analysis is based on monthly deflated card payment data for Brazil from January 2007 to March 2017. / A Inclusão financeira é um objetivo de política pública que procura desenvolvimento através do acesso de todos aos serviços financeiros.
